The Geograph project started in 2005 with the aim of publishing, organising and preserving representative images for every square kilometre of Great Britain, Ireland and the Isle of Man.

The bank building, on the corner of High Street and Bridge Street, was Grade II listed in February 1980 (as the National Westminster Bank).
